GPIO Port T Power Control
The Pn bit encodings are not applicable if the corresponding bit in the
RCGCGPIO, SCGCGPIO or DCGCGPIO register is clear.
DescriptionValue
GPIO Port T is not powered and does not receive a clock. In
this case, the module's state is not retained.
This configuration provides the lowest power consumption state.
0
GPIO Port T is powered, but does not receive a clock. In this
case, the module is inactive.
1
